  • @09tranm I'm a recovered exercise & purging bulimic, ya know, it's an illness. 3 hours a day: normal for some? Yes. Absolutely. Normal when you're eating under 400 calories a day: NO absolutely not. This is why it's so dangerous. Too much exercise when you are not eating hardly at all causes electrolyte imbalances, protein, potassium and iron deficiencies, anemia and amenorrhea. It's dangerous. and that is why it's too much.

  • @BinkieMcFartnuggets I'm not arguing with you but exercise bulimia is not just about overexercising - the exercise is a way of purging calories that are eaten during binges.

    Overexercising on its own is just compulsive exercise or exercise addiction.
